About Evermore
Evermore Orlando Resort is an innovative 1,100-acre resort adjacent to Walt Disney World® featuring centrally owned upscale and upsized vacation rental homes, flats & villas, a luxury Conrad hotel, 36 holes of world-class Jack Nicklaus golf, and a massive 20-acre tropical beach complex around Evermore Bay, our 8-acre crystalline water amenity by Crystal Lagoons®. The surrounding beach areas feature zero-entry swim areas, bars, cabanas, private firepits, a lively food hall & gourmet market, a casual dining restaurant, and an event Boathouse that will provide a picture-perfect backdrop for weddings, banquets, and corporate meetings. Position Summary: The General Manager of Outlets will be leading all assigned food & beverage outlets that currently include Craft Burgers, Prop’s Pizza, That’s A Wrap!, Sandhill Provisions, Ebb & Flow Bar & Restaurant, Barbara Ann’s Beachside Bar, in addition to Bayside service, Evermore to your Door, golf hospitality carts, portable beverage carts and food trucks. This individual will ensure high standards of food & beverage quality and service while maximizing profits. The General Manager of Outlets will be responsible for designing and implementing standard operating procedures, establishing training procedures and processes, maintaining strong expense controls and financial management, overseeing internal controls and audits, and oversight of state & county inspections and licensing.
